Devil May Cry 3 Special Edition is, as the name suggests, a re-release of the 2005 Capcom title that includes numerous additional modes, such as the ability to play the story with Vergil and the Bloody Palace. With the Switch version, further innovations have been brought, revealed during the last few weeks by the manufacturer of the game, but I will talk about these later.

At the plot level, DMC3 is chronologically placed as the first chapter of the series, in fact we find the young Dante who has just arrived in his shop, still unnamed. Not even the time to open a shop, which are already starting to appear strange creatures and a mysterious tower, which acts as a portal between our world and that of the demons. I will not talk further about the history of the game, I will just say that, despite being a very side element, this is not completely trivial, but rather has a couple of unexpected twists.

One of the best elements outside the gameplay are the characters, especially Dante, the half demon, and his twin brother and main antagonist, Vergil. The first is a hot-headed, bold and always ready to provoke his opponents (so much so that there is a button dedicated to this), but precisely this makes him immediately likeable and appreciable. With his way of doing, Dante immediately makes it clear that the game does not have too serious tones (even if it has its moments towards the end, showing us, for example, that “even demons can cry”), but rather points to exaggeration and student spirit as the main element, even in the gameplay. Vergil is the exact opposite, cold and stoic, and he is the perfect rival for our protagonist.

How is Dante’s student spirit reflected in the gameplay? For better or worse, it can be found everywhere. If the series, and this chapter  in particular, are not familiar to you, you should know that these are action games based on fast attacks and combos, which are associated with a score (from D to SSS) based on how many attacks you they manage to do without the enemy being able to respond. The game wants us to be stylish, so repeating the same actions over and over  will not increase the points, but luckily there is a huge variety of weapons and moves that we can use.

In addition to the Rebellion sword and the Ebony & Ivory pistols, we find in fact many other weapons, all extremely different from them and each with unique abilities, which are unlocked as you progress with the game and level up the styles .

Styles are one of the main mechanics of the game and were introduced into the series by Devil May Cry 3. Initially we will have four available, which are Trickster, Swordmaster, Gunslinger and Royalguard, but later we will get two more, Quicksilver and Doppelganger. Each of these styles offers different skills based on the level: for example Trickster allows you to perform a shot with invincibility, Swordmaster and Gunslinger instead unlock additional techniques for the sidearm and firearm respectively, while Royalguard allows you to parry attacks and then return the blow. The latter in particular completely changes the way of approaching the game, even without combining it with the other styles.

You heard right, in the Nintendo Switch edition , the free-style mode has been introduced , which allows you to change the style on the spot by pressing the corresponding button on the dpad. By doing so, it is possible to indulge even more in combat, combining the offensive power of the Swordmaster with the defense of Royalguard and Trickster for example.

We can’t forget Dante’s ability, the Devil Trigger . After a certain mission, Dante will unlock the ability to transform into a demon, greatly increasing his strength and speed. This will make it harder for enemies to parry your attacks, while you can do even longer combos. The duration of this technique will depend on your magical power, which you can increase by buying the respective power-ups. Don’t be stingy with this special technique: reloading the magical power is easy and you can activate it multiple times during the same boss battle.

So we come to the focal point of the game, precisely the boss battles . The thing that immediately surprised me is that, despite the large number, these are very unique among them as regards the mechanics and the possible puzzles behind. In general, you can also face them calmly, waiting for the right moment to attack, unleash your combo and then run away. In short, great for novice players, but what if you are looking for a more interesting challenge? Don’t look elsewhere because DMC has thought of you too. Here, in fact, the system of points comes into play, to maximize which it will be necessary to attack constantly, obviously being careful not to be hit. Depending on the style you want to use, each fight will always be different and more or less difficult.

Honorable mention goes to the fights with Vergil , who being a half demon like us has at his disposal not only his weapons and his superhuman abilities, but also the Devil Trigger, which makes him extremely dangerous. They are extremely adrenaline-pumping battles, made of parries, dodges and counterattacks, and represent the pinnacle of the game’s combat system.

In addition to the main story, there are also tons of things that can be done in Devil May Cry 3 Special Edition. First of all you can replay the various missions trying to get the maximum score, which I assure you is a great satisfaction of his. In addition to this you can replay the story with Vergil, who has his own gameplay, quite different from Dante.

If that’s still not enough for you, the Special Edition introduced the Palace of Blood 14 years ago, a series of battles against generic enemies and bosses one after the other. Here, too, the Switch version brings a novelty , namely the possibility of playing together with another person, one in control of Dante and one of Vergil. In short, now you can play this fantastic title with a friend, what else do you want?

Clearly, no game is without defects, but this one has the only problem of being a bit of a child of its time: there are some cutscenes that are clearly the originals, in very low definition and not in HD like the rest of the game (and also there it is however noted that the title has a certain age). But the element that can really be annoying is the camera, especially with enemies that move a lot. These in fact risk ending up out of sight and the camera doesn’t move very quickly unfortunately, so you end up potentially being hit if you’re not too careful.

Devil May Cry 3 Special Edition is a fantastic action game, with deep gameplay and awesome boss battles. The characters are very charismatic, even if there are only four, and Vergil in particular is just perfect for how he is built before the fights. The very wide variety of weapons, styles and moves, combined with the many modes present in the game, greatly increases the hours that we can dedicate to ourselves, both alone and with friends. The only flaws are the camera which is sometimes annoying, the graphics sector, especially in certain scenes, which can be seen to be old and some typos every now and then. Not much compared to how fun and rewarding this game is.
